Portion Guide:
On average, one pound of smoked meat serves about 3–4 people, depending on appetite and the number of sides ordered. This simple guideline can help you plan the right quantity for your catering event.

v) Catering Packages & Pricing
Customizable packages are available for different group sizes:
| People | Smoked Meat | Sides | Bakery & Sauce | Price |
| 5 | 2 lbs | 1.5 qt | Included | $59.95 |
| 10 | 4 lbs | 3 qt | Included | $119.90 |
| 20 | 8 lbs | 6 qt | Included | $239.80 |
| 30 | 12 lbs | 9 qt | Included | $359.70 |
| 40 | 16 lbs | 12 qt | Included | $479.60 |
Note: Prices may vary by location and availability.

iv) Support for Veterans & Military Appreciation
Founded in 2011 by Bill Kraus and Steve Newton, Mission BBQ was created to honor military personnel, police officers, firefighters, and first responders. The company plays the national anthem daily at noon and participates in charitable initiatives. In 2023, Mission BBQ raised $347,068 through the American Hero’s Cup campaign to provide wreaths for veterans’ graves, reflecting their commitment to those who serve.

iii) Staffed Buffet or Large Event Catering
- Visit the Mission BBQ catering page.
- Fill out the catering request form with event details.
- Optional: request a complimentary tasting if you’re unsure about the menu.
- Mission BBQ recommends at least 48 hours’ notice, though some orders can be fulfilled in under 24 hours.
- A credit card secures your order; payment is processed on the day of the event.
- For staffed buffets, book early availability is first-come, first-served.

(History)
Mission BBQ was founded in 2011 by Bill Kraus and Steve Newton in Glen Burnie, Maryland, USA. The brand was created with a dual mission: to serve authentic, slow-smoked barbecue and to honor and support military personnel, police officers, firefighters, and first responders.
From its first location, Mission BBQ grew quickly due to its focus on high-quality smoked meats, traditional recipes, and patriotic values. One of its signature practices is playing the National Anthem daily at noon in every location, reflecting its deep respect for those who serve the nation.
Over the years, Mission BBQ has expanded to over 140 locations across the United States, becoming known not only for its delicious BBQ but also for its charitable initiatives. The brand’s growth combines culinary excellence, strong community values, and a commitment to honoring first responders, making Mission BBQ a unique and respected name in the American barbecue scene.

3. How much BBQ should I order per person?
A good rule of thumb is ¼ to ⅓ pound of meat per person, depending on appetite and sides.
4. How much BBQ should I order for 50 people?
For 50 guests, plan around 12–16 pounds of meat, plus sides and bakery items to ensure everyone is satisfied.

9. Does Mission BBQ accommodate dietary restrictions?
Yes, most menu items are gluten-free (except breads and mac & cheese), and vegetarian/vegan options like vegan Italian sausage and salads are available.
